Step-by-Step Guide to Connect Inverter to Battery
What You Need Before Starting
Before you connect an inverter to a battery, make sure you have the right equipment and safety gear:
- Inverter unit (right capacity for your load)
- Battery (tubular/lead-acid/SMF depending on requirement)
- Battery cables with correct gauge and connectors
- Safety gloves and goggles
- Wrench or pliers
Safety Precautions
Working with batteries and electrical equipment can be hazardous. Follow these precautions:
- Place the inverter and battery in a well-ventilated area.
- Keep them away from direct sunlight, flames, and water.
- Make sure your hands and tools are dry before working.
- Never place metal objects on top of the battery.
Step-by-step Connection Process
-
1. Place the Inverter and Battery
Put both devices on a flat, stable surface. Ensure the battery is ventilated—batteries can emit gases.
-
2. Identify the Terminals
Locate the positive (+) and negative (–) terminals on both the battery and inverter. Common color codes: red = positive, black = negative.
-
3. Connect the Positive Terminal
Using a red battery cable, connect battery positive (+) to inverter positive (+). Tighten the connector securely.
-
4. Connect the Negative Terminal
Using a black cable, connect battery negative (–) to inverter negative (–). Make sure the connection is snug.
-
5. Double-Check Connections
Verify there are no loose wires and that positive-to-positive and negative-to-negative connections are correct.
-
6. Switch On the Inverter
Turn on the inverter following the manufacturer’s instructions. Test with a small load first to confirm correct operation.
Extra Tips
- Match the battery capacity to your inverter model and desired backup time.
- For lead-acid batteries, check water levels periodically.
- Keep terminals clean; use petroleum jelly to prevent corrosion.
- Never load the inverter beyond its rated power capacity.
